Output 37a66233e4cb69a10715490095e515f60cdb66817645463870ca65f6b8af3801:7

value
39716094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c532fb1fa61f7d102dbe0ba78528d5cfcee50bd3 OP_EQUAL
address
MRsrRSSQK5VBQzcCTWC4eEYJi3GGjn2nWg
transaction
37a66233e4cb69a10715490095e515f60cdb66817645463870ca65f6b8af3801
spent
true